Comment (by [EMAIL PROTECTED]):

 This seems to be a very weak distribution.  I looked at several messages
 from http://dmesg.printk.net/pipermail/mit-devel/ and there are requests
 for man pages and fixing distclean, but the developer, evidently only one
 person, responds to the messages, but doesn't implement the requests.

 I can't find a current git tree.

 The Changelog for 3.4 has no entries.  I have no confidence in any of the
 other support files, README, INSTALL, etc either as they appear to be
 quite old.

 I don't know if it is worthwhile even posting something on the mailing
 list.  Somewhere I saw a request to cc the developer, so it appears that
 he isn't even subscribed himself.
